Antique ARTS & CRAFTS Shaving Mirror MISSION Oak Stickley Era - W1422 This is an antique Arts & Crafts shaving mirror from the early 1900s in very good condition. It has a wonderful selection of quarter sawn oak. The mirror has the original finish. Attractive form with tapered posts and shoe feet. The mirror has no damage. We do not deal in "Flea Market" type items. RESTORATION: When Restoration is needed, we employ an experienced restoration technician and/or a professional artist. Traditional methods and materials are utilized to remedy any concerns. Hide glue was used during construction of furniture in the early 1900s. Such glue deteriorates over time, often creating a need for reworking in order for furniture to continue to be sturdy and strong. Furniture not properly restored does not honor the piece, nor protect the financial investment made by the buyer.
